I have the Desh Industries kit for my Axis II, and it is a massssssssive improvement over stock. Its a simple couple of thrust bearings and a washer between them, plus trimming your spring a little bit - but the normally gritty bolt lift is completely gone. You can kind of get away with it with a hardware store hardened stainless steel washer, but the the thrust bearings are easily noticeably better than that. You may need or not need the spacer the kit comes with, or it may even need a little bit of sanding down... each gun is slightly different.

my axis ii with the lift kit,


I also put on a Glades Armory extended and knurled bolt handle, which further improved the bolt lift. The extra leverage is very helpful.
